Title

Sodium saccharin Mediated one-pot Synthesis of 2-amino-4H-Chromene Derivatives in Aqueous Media

Abstract

In the present protocol, a Sodium saccharin catalyst was utilized for the one-pot three-component cyclo condensation reaction of Aromatic Aldehyde, Barbituric acid, and dimedone, in water as environmentally benign water as a green medium at 80oC temperature within 30 minutes of reaction time in ethanol: water solvent system. The current method has major advantages like mild reaction conditions with a simple operation process, high yields, by using a less toxic and lower costlier catalyst.
